Diffuse Optical Imaging

**Semantic type:** Diagnostic Procedure

**Definition:** A method of rendering images using near-infrared spectroscopic or fluorescence techniques. It is most commonly used to measure changes in oxygenated and deoxygenated hemoglobin concentrations as an indicator of wound or injury healing.
